kicia Posted August 10, 2015 #6 Share Posted August 10, 2015 Carnival recently revised their policy to ONE bottle per person over 21 on embarkation day only... I'm not sure about the B2B part... That's not a revision because it has always been that way - one bottle of wine/champagne per adult over 21 on embarkation day. For a B2B you can bring on two bottles per person as long as you have both boarding passes with you.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
